Isaac F. Carr 1869–1870 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1869-10-23

Birth Location: Clinton County, Kentucky

Death Date: 1870-03-29

Death Location: Cedar Hill Cemetery, Albany, Clinton, Kentucky

Father: George Carr

Mother: Sarah Leslie

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1869, Isaac F. Carr entered the world in Clinton County, Kentucky, born to George Wesley Carr And Sarah Susan Leslie. In 1870, Isaac F. Carr was recorded in the census in Clinton County, Kentucky. Isaac F. Carr passed away in 1870 in Cedar Hill Cemetery, Albany, Clinton, Kentucky.
